This entertaining and light-hearted series revolves around a group of friends engaged in Dungeons & Dragons (D&D) gameplay, showcasing their comedic interactions and adventurous escapades. Each episode beautifully blends humor and creativity, highlighting character growth through whimsical storylines that often involve magical transformations, unexpected mishaps, and engaging character dynamics. Audiences can expect an array of fantastical settings, including enchanting locations like the Feywild, where absurd scenarios unfold with each roll of the dice, often leading to hilariously chaotic outcomes.
